单词 | wildly |
释义 | wildly 1.(hugely)+ different, happy, inaccurate, improbable, optimistic, popular, successful非常;极其;vary, differ +巨大地;exaggerate +过于;极其 The government's forecasts are wildly optimistic.政府的预测过于乐观了。 a wildly successful choreographer一位极其成功的舞蹈编导 The scheme has proved wildly popular.事实证明该计划非常受欢迎。 They gave wildly different versions of what happened.对于所发生的事情他们给出了完全不同的说法。 The standard varies wildly.标准非常参差不齐。 2.(energetically)applaud, cheer, wave, gesticulate +狂热地;激动地 The audience applauded wildly.观众热烈鼓掌。 Peter was gesticulating wildly from halfway up the steps.彼得在楼梯半截处激动地打着手势。 3.(violently)猛烈地;激烈地 She struck at him wildly.她狠命地朝他打过去。 4.(frantically)狂暴地;疯狂地 My heart started beating wildly like a trapped bird.我的心像一只被困的小鸟, 开始狂躁地跳动起来。 5.+ angry愤怒地;暴怒地 He was wildly angry when he heard what I'd done.当听到我的所作所为时, 他怒火中烧。 6.(at random)hit, grab, guess +胡乱地;随便地;任意地 She splashed about wildly, trying to reach the edge of the pool.她胡乱地拍打着池水, 试图游到池边。 |
